#2fdde4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2fdde4 is composed of 18.4% red, 86.7%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.4% cyan, 3.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 182.3 degrees, a saturation of 77% and a lightness of 53.9%. #2fdde4 color hex could be obtained by blending #5effff with #00bbc9.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#2fdde4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2fdde4 has RGB values of R:47, G:221, B:228 and CMYK values of C:0.79, M:0.03,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 3136996.
